Best advice given - consider the height of your bike and seat and where you'd like your arm to rest. I've employed 12.5" and 16" apes on my 02' Road King with a Mustang single rider seat. The 16" apes were just right for me at 6'2", where my hands were at heart height (not at or above my shoulders). With a different seat, the results could have been different, lower or taller apes.
